Cape Town - The EFF will never accept parliamentary rules that would compel them to relinquish their red workers uniforms, MP Godrich Gardee said on Thursday amid plans to impose a dress code for the legislature. It will never happen. We are here to do serious work, not to discuss dress codes, he told Sapa. Where will it end? Next thing they will be telling us which colour underwear to wear and how to speak, Gardee said. Had they existed at the time such rules may have prevented former president Nelson Mandela from wearing his trademark Madiba shirts to Parliament, he said.
